RE: tmon

  • From: Noveljic Nenad <nenad.noveljic@xxxxxxxxxxx>
  • To: "'Sweetser, Joe'" <JSweetser@xxxxxxxx>, "ORACLE-L (oracle-l@xxxxxxxxxxxxx)" <oracle-l@xxxxxxxxxxxxx>
  • Date: Mon, 18 Sep 2017 14:28:54 +0000

Thank you Joe, the information you sent was helpful to find the root-cause!

tmon terminated the instance without giving much details in the alert log:

TMON (ospid: 14954): terminating the instance due to error 472

But as the relationship between tmon and tt0* processes has become clear 
(thanks to your updates!), I looked for tt0 in the system state dump.

PROCESS 36: TT00
...
O/S info: user: oracle, term: UNKNOWN, ospid: 14994 (DEAD)

Somebody shot down the tt0!

But who might it be?

I recalled a similar case once upon a time where I had used DTrace back then to 
find out the culprit: http://nenadnoveljic.com/blog/avaloq-database-crash/

It was this dodgy application again which runs on the database server under the 
oracle account (the vendor imposed setup!) and executes kill -9 commands to 
kill the application processes (take no prisoners!). Just sometimes they don't 
get the PIDs right . So, this time the TT0 was an innocent victim of this 
violence act.

Many thanks once again,

Nenad



From: Sweetser, Joe [mailto:JSweetser@xxxxxxxx]
Sent: Montag, 18. September 2017 15:52
To: Noveljic Nenad; ORACLE-L (oracle-l@xxxxxxxxxxxxx)
Subject: RE: tmon

Interesting that it's not listed here: 
https://docs.oracle.com/database/121/REFRN/GUID-86184690-5531-405F-AA05-BB935F57B76D.htm

But from here:  
http://akashpramanik.blogspot.com/2015/04/background-processes-in-oracle-database.html

I see this: TMON starts the TMON slave (called the TT processes) and monitors a 
number of redo transport processes for hangs and death.

hth,
-joe

From: oracle-l-bounce@xxxxxxxxxxxxx<mailto:oracle-l-bounce@xxxxxxxxxxxxx
[mailto:oracle-l-bounce@xxxxxxxxxxxxx] On Behalf Of Noveljic Nenad
Sent: Monday, September 18, 2017 7:41 AM
To: ORACLE-L (oracle-l@xxxxxxxxxxxxx<mailto:oracle-l@xxxxxxxxxxxxx>) 
<oracle-l@xxxxxxxxxxxxx<mailto:oracle-l@xxxxxxxxxxxxx>>
Subject: tmon

Hi,

What does the tmon background process do?

Best regards,

Nenad


____________________________________________________
Please consider the environment before printing this e-mail.
Bitte denken Sie an die Umwelt, bevor Sie dieses E-Mail drucken.

Important Notice

This message is intended only for the individual named. It may contain 
confidential or privileged information. If you are not the named addressee you 
should in particular not disseminate, distribute, modify or copy this e-mail. 
Please notify the sender immediately by e-mail, if you have received this 
message by mistake and delete it from your system.

E-mail transmission may not be secure or error-free as information could be 
intercepted, corrupted, lost, destroyed, arrive late or incomplete. Also 
processing of incoming e-mails cannot be guaranteed. All liability of the 
Vontobel Group and its affiliates for any damages resulting from e-mail use is 
excluded. You are advised that urgent and time sensitive messages should not be 
sent by e-mail and if verification is required please request a printed version.
Confidentiality Note: This message contains information that may be 
confidential and/or privileged. If you are not the intended recipient, you 
should not use, copy, disclose, distribute or take any action based on this 
message. If you have received this message in error, please advise the sender 
immediately by reply email and delete this message. Although ICAT, Underwriters 
at Lloyd's, Syndicate 4242, scans e-mail and attachments for viruses, it does 
not guarantee that either are virus-free and accepts no liability for any 
damage sustained as a result of viruses. Thank you.

<html xmlns="http://www.w3.org/1999/xhtml";>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
<style type="text/css">p { font-family: Arial;font-size:9pt }</style>
</head>
<body>
<p>
<br>Important Notice</br>
<br>This message is intended only for the individual named. It may contain 
confidential or privileged information. If you are not the named addressee you 
should in particular not disseminate, distribute, modify or copy this e-mail. 
Please notify the sender immediately by e-mail, if you have received this 
message by mistake and delete it from your system.</br>
<br>E-mail transmission may not be secure or error-free as information could be 
intercepted, corrupted, lost, destroyed, arrive late or incomplete. Also 
processing of incoming e-mails cannot be guaranteed. All liability of the 
Vontobel Group and its affiliates for any damages resulting from e-mail use is 
excluded. You are advised that urgent and time sensitive messages should not be 
sent by e-mail and if verification is required please request a printed 
version.<br/>
</p>
</body>
</html>

  • References:

Other related posts: